NFL Rumors: Tyron Smith, Jets Agree to Contract in Free Agency After Cowboys Tenure

After 13 successful seasons with the Dallas Cowboys, Tyron Smith is going to play for a new team in 2024.

Per NFL insider Jordan Schultz, the eight-time Pro Bowler will sign with the New York Jets.

Smith has been an integral part of Dallas' success on offense since he was drafted with the ninth overall pick in 2011.

The 33-year-old began his career as a right tackle when Doug Free was starting on the left side.
